Hybrid Hearing Aids With Basic Set of Adjustment
|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.The Lexie B2s are a non prescription hybrid style hearing aid. Hybrid because they're a mix of the external hearing aids where the entire unit sits externally behind the ear and the style with an in-ear receiver. The expected benefits of this are noise isolation and better sound pickup and reproduction while maintaining a slim look. These are powered with rechargeable batteries which charge in the storage case. They're also Bluetooth enabled which is how you'll fine tune the hearing aids. Note, this does not let you listen to music or audio over Bluetooth, it is strictly a hearing aid. In the box you get the B2 hearing aids, charging case and USB C cable, two additional sizes of domes beyond the ones pre-installed on the receiver and a cleaning brush. On the hearing aid body are volume controls, the microphone, and charging contacts. You power on and off the B2s by holding the volume down buttons for three seconds. Generally, you should be wearing the hearing aids before powering them on. The hearing aids will also turn off when placed in the case. They will magnetically latch in place which helps keep things from randomly falling out and let you have a tactile feel that things are place for charging. Configuring the B2s is with a Bluetooth app. The hearing aids automatically enter pairing mode for a few minutes when powered on so connecting to them should be straightforward. The settings and tuning are relatively limited. Aside from volume, you can adjust bass and treble, left and right balance, directionally (whether to focus on sound all around you or in front). The app also has environmental settings which are pre-configured profiles of the settings I just mentioned. You can also create your own. Also, you can mute the hearing aids in the app. The basic audio adjustment settings worked well and the B2s are functional as hearing aids. However, with Bluetooth functionality, I was expecting to be able to have more equalizer like control over frequency response which is not present. Also, there is no way to select between environments on the hearing aid itself. So if the user is someone who regularly uses android or IOS smartphones things are fine. If not, the user is stuck with just one environmental setting and can only adjust the hearing aid volume. The app let's you check the battery level so you know when to charge. Otherwise, you just get a "battery low" spoken warning which doesn't give you that much advance warning. That said, the batteries are good for about a full day of use so as long as you ensure to always store them overnight in a plugged-in charging case, you should be fine.

Good controls within the app
|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Once these are in, they fit securely on top of your ear - it actually sits more on top of your ear than behind it, probably to aid the mic in picking up sound - but it can require a bit of dexterity to maneuver the tip of the plug into your ear canal. For someone who is starting to lose some of that manual dexterity, it can be a little difficult. Once in, the wire is not very visible. Unless you knew to look for them, they're probably not noticeable at all, at first glance. There can be quite a bit of noise from touching the main body of the hearing aid while getting it into position, but once there, it doesn't move around at all, so unless you specifically touch it for some reason, it won't pick up any contact noise. While it does have buttons on the back for adjusting the volume and powering on and off, you're better off using the app. There are controls to adjust overall volume and whether to pick up sounds mostly from the front or from all around. You can also adjust a single slider that can bias the sound more towards treble or bass. There is also a nice feature in the app that lets you basically create four preset control configurations, depending on the environments you commonly find yourself in. You can use the preset configurations for those environments or tailor them to your liking. It is also not that difficult to change the bluetooth pairing from one phone to another or to clear out the pairing history. It does come with three different sizes of ear tips, but if you need a different length of wire, you have to order that. Easy setup and easy to use controls make this a solid choice.

Works as Intended
|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.In the box are the hearing aids, the charging case, a charging cord (USB to USB-C), very large instructional manual, quick start guide, additional ear adaptors and a cleaning brush. First impression, I love the smaller charging case but there are no indicators on the exterior to know how much battery life is left or if the hearing aids are charging. Out of the box, charge the hearing aids. I followed the quick start guide and attempted to connect the hearing aids to the Lexie app (the recommended app) on my phone and I had a hard time. I finally opened the instruction manual and it does state that if the hearing aids aren’t charged enough, they will not pair with the device. Another note, pair with the app and not the Bluetooth setting on the phone. If the aids are connected with the Bluetooth setting, they will not connect with the app. Another note, the charge case blinks when the hearing aids are charging and stops blinking and has a solid white light when they are fully charged. I plugged in the charge cord and after about 20-30 minutes, one aid was fully charged and the other was still blinking. I checked in an hour and both aids were fully charged. I attempted to pair the aids again with the Lexie app and they paired right away. In the app, you can change the settings, i.e. the volume, the way the aids listen (front or everywhere), what type of setting you are in (outdoors, crowd). I used the aids first to watch tv since I tend to turn up the volume higher than normal to hear. The hearing aids worked pretty good, I was able to turn the tv way down and I had the aids about mid way on the volume with the direction set to everywhere. My daughter started talking to me and I could definitely hear her over the television which is good but when she was not talking to me, I could still hear her over the tv. Keep in mind that there are no indicator lights on the aids, so when you take them out of the case, they do not automatically turn on but they do turn off when you place them in the charge case. When you take them out, you press the down button and listen for a sound which indicates they are on and in pairing mode. If the aids don’t connect to the app, go to your settings and make sure they aren’t paired to the phone Bluetooth setting. If they are, disconnect and the aids should reconnect with the app. Overall, the hearing aids do work but keep in mind that they are simple and not super fancy and they work best with the Lexie app. Also, they do pair with the phone but they don’t work with the phone, meaning, you can’t make or listen to calls or music on your phone with your aids. If you have small ears and wear glasses, keep in mind that the aids are a little thick behind your ears, so it maybe bulky if you are wearing glasses, a mask and the aids all at once. My ears did get sore after wearing for over 4 hours with glasses and I also had to get used to the inserts as well. The inserts did make my ears itch a little on Day 1 and 2 but I am starting to get used to them now on Day 3. I would recommend with high caution of what the hearing aids can actually do to friends and family.

Entry level hearing aid for minor hearing loss
|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.To start, I wanted to try the Lexie B2 OTC hearing aids as I have some hearing loss from being a drummer and DJ in my earlier years. I'm constantly asking people to repeat themselves and have quite a bit of difficulty hearing conversation in noisy environments like bars and restaurants. So - yes I was excited to try them out. Right to the point - the Lexia B2 seem to be just an amplifier for your ear. It amplifies everything - perhaps too much. As I'm typing this, I'm wearing the devices with my World Volume set to 18 of 100 set to an Everyday Listening environment, and the clicking of my keyboard is quite loud. Rustling of papers or a paper chip bag is nearly unbearable. On the PLUS side, I wore the devices for nearly a whole day before I told my family members I was wearing them. Either they don't look at me very closely, or they are hidden very well. I prefer to think the latter is the true. Battery life is also good - I can easily wear them a whole day 8+ hours without draining them completely. In addition, they are very light and comfortable - so much so that I almost forget that I'm wearing them. The Lexie app is also quite functional when it works. On the CONS side, I was quite disappointed that the Lexia B2's don't function as bluetooth streaming devices for audio or phone calls. I would have thought that would be a very common feature to build in - maybe the B3's will have them. Also, the Lexie B2's did come with a new case for charging them in, but it's just a case - they didn't build in a battery for charging them. Most earbuds and devices come with a rechargable case vs just a carrying case. My last con is about connecting to the Lexie app. I'd say my devices connect about 50% of the time. I power them on and place them on/in my ears, then launch the Lexie app. My phone is within 2 feet of the devices, but it cannot connect. I either have to try to restart the devices or place them back in the case - then try again. Overall, the Lexie B2 OTC Hearing Aids Powered by Bose work well as a sound amplifier, but I personally expected something with the Bose name to be much more function, refined and feature rich.
